Operation Management
What is operations management?

Operations management defined
Operations management is the activity of managing the resources which are devoted to the production and delivery of products and services.

The best way to start understanding the nature of ‘operations’ is to look around you Everything you can see around you (except the flesh and blood) has been processed by an operation Every service you consumed today (radio station, bus service, lecture, etc.) has also been produced by an operation Operations Managers create everything you buy, sit on, wear, eat, throw at people, and throw away

Operations management at IKEA
Design elegant products which can be flat-packed efficiently Design a store layout which gives smooth and effective flow Ensure that the jobs of all staff encourage their contribution to business success

Site stores of an appropriate size in the most effective locations

Continually examine and improve operations practice

Maintain cleanliness and safety of storage area

Monitor and enhance quality of service to customers Arrange for fast replenishment of products

    Operations management focuses on carefully managing the processes to produce and distribute products and services. Usually, small businesses don't talk about "operations management", but they carry out the activities that management schools typically associate with the phrase "operations management." Major, overall activities often include product creation, development, production and distribution. (These activities are also associated with Product and Service Management. However product management is usually in regard to one or more closely related product -- that is, a product line. Operations management is in regard to all operations within the organization.) Related activities include managing purchases, inventory control, quality control, storage, logistics and evaluations. A great deal of focus is on efficiency and effectiveness of processes. Therefore, operations management often includes substantial measurement and analysis of internal processes.…
